Germany, Wehrmacht. A 1939 Iron Cross I Class, with Case, by B.H. Mayer Newly Listed to whom the Star (the(Eisernes Kreuz 1939 I. Klasse mit Etui). Reinstituted 1 September 1939. (1939 1945 issue). Constructed of iron and silver, consisting of a Cross Patte with a blackened magnetic iron core within a ribbed silver frame, the obverse with a central mobile swastika, the six oclock arm with a reinstitution date of 1939, the reverse with a block hinge and banjo style pinback meeting a flat wire catch, the pinback maker marked with Prsidialkanlzei code 26 for
